Paul Russell wrote:
> Does L-Soft have plans to add support for the use of the List-Id header
> described in RFC 2919

Excellent suggestion Paul. :)

That RFC is along the same lines as RFC 2369. 2369 proposes a set of
headers that give 'hints' for common subscription-related functions.  
For example, this list might have a header that reads:

List-Unsubscribe:  <http://peach.ease.lsoft.com/scripts/wa.exe?SUBED1=LSTSRV-L>,
        <mailto:[log in to unmask]>

E-mail programs are slowly starting to incorporate this.

The only issue I can perceive is that of the bulk it creates in the
header. You could opt not to add this information if the subscriber is set 
to SHORTHDR. Not sure.
